What is an industrial electrical maintenance?

An Industrial Electrical Maintenance job involves installing, repairing, and maintaining electrical systems in industrial settings such as factories, plants, and manufacturing facilities. Technicians troubleshoot electrical issues, ensure equipment operates efficiently, and follow safety regulations to prevent hazards. They work with wiring, motors, control panels, and automation systems to minimize downtime and maintain productivity. Strong problem-solving skills and knowledge of electrical codes are essential for success in this role.

What types of equipment or systems will I commonly work with in an industrial electrical maintenance role?

In an Industrial Electrical Maintenance position, you will frequently work with high- and low-voltage electrical systems, motors, control panels, conveyors, and automated machinery. You may also interact with programmable logic controllers (PLCs), variable frequency drives (VFDs), and various types of sensors and switches. Routine responsibilities often include troubleshooting electrical faults, performing preventive maintenance, and conducting repairs to ensure equipment operates safely and efficiently. This role usually requires collaboration with production and engineering teams to quickly resolve issues and support continuous plant operations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in industrial electrical maintenance, and why are they important?

To excel in Industrial Electrical Maintenance, you need strong problem-solving skills, a solid understanding of electrical systems, and experience with industrial equipment, typically supported by a vocational diploma or apprenticeship in electrical maintenance. Familiarity with programmable logic controllers (PLCs), electrical testing tools, and adherence to safety standards such as OSHA is essential. Strong attention to detail, effective communication, and the ability to work both independently and in teams are valuable soft skills. These qualities ensure that maintenance tasks are performed efficiently, safely, and in accordance with regulatory requirements, minimizing downtime for industrial operations.

Is industrial electrical maintenance a good career?

Industrial electrical maintenance is a stable career that involves inspecting, repairing, and maintaining electrical systems in industrial settings. It often requires technical skills, certifications such as an electrician license, and knowledge of tools like PLCs and motor controls. The job typically offers good job prospects, competitive wages, and opportunities for advancement.

Industrial Electrical Manager

Rinvio

Davenport, IA • On-site

$55 - $75/hr

Contractor

Re-posted 12 days ago


Job description

Rinvio is hiring a Industrial Electrical Manager for an industrial skilled-trades role in the Davenport, IA market. This is an hourly contract role; exact client and site details are shared only with qualified candidates.


Pay: $55.00 - $75.00 / hr, based on experience and fit for the scope.

Type: Contract.

Public location: Public posting uses a market location and does not expose the client site.


Primary scope: electrical maintenance leadership, plant reliability, electrical project coordination, safety, planning, and team supervision.

What you will do:

  • Lead electrical maintenance priorities, troubleshooting escalation, work planning, safety expectations, and reliability improvements.
  • Coordinate electricians, controls support, outside vendors, outage work, spare parts, and plant electrical projects.
  • Track work status, constraints, PM completion, equipment issues, and follow-up actions for plant leadership.

Background that fits:

  • Industrial electrical leadership experience in manufacturing, heavy industrial, utilities, steel, or plant maintenance
  • Strong technical understanding of power distribution, controls, motors, drives, troubleshooting, and electrical safety
  • Able to lead field teams, plan work, document priorities, and keep production stakeholders aligned
